20 Mil vs 22 Mil Wear Layer: Does the Difference Actually Matter?
· 7 min read

If you've shopped luxury vinyl plank for more than an afternoon, someone has quoted you a wear-layer number. It's the spec the industry leads with, and for good reason — it's the single best predictor of how a floor will look in ten years. It's also the spec most often used to upsell you.
So let's answer the question directly: between a 20-mil and a 22-mil wear layer, the practical difference in a home is negligible. The meaningful gap is much further down the range, and it's the one most retail flooring never mentions. Here's how to read the number properly.
What a wear layer actually is
The wear layer is the clear, tough film on top of the plank. It sits above the printed layer that gives the floor its wood look, and it is the only thing standing between that print and your life — dog nails, chair legs, grit tracked in from the driveway, a dropped cast-iron pan.
It is not the total thickness of the plank. This trips people up constantly. Our plank is 5.5mm thick overall, but the wear layer inside it is 20 mil. Two completely different measurements of two different things, and a salesperson quoting you "5.5mm" when you asked about the wear layer is either confused or hoping you are.
A mil is one-thousandth of an inch. So 20 mil is 0.020" — about the thickness of five sheets of printer paper. That sounds impossibly thin to carry a floor for twenty years, and yet it does, because it's a hard urethane-coated film, not a coat of paint.
- Wear layer — the clear protective film on top. Measured in mils. This is the durability spec.
- Overall thickness — the whole plank, core included. Measured in millimetres. This is a rigidity and feel spec.
- Core — what's underneath. Ours is SPC (stone polymer composite), which is what makes the plank dimensionally stable.
Where the real cliff is: 6–12 mil vs 20 mil
Here's the part the wear-layer conversation usually skips. Most vinyl plank sold into homes runs a 6 to 12 mil wear layer. That's the builder-grade plank in a spec house, and it's most of what you'll find at a big-box store at an attractive price per square foot.
A 20-mil wear layer is a commercial specification. It's what gets put down in retail stores and offices, where the floor takes a thousand pairs of shoes a day and the owner can't afford to redo it in five years.
That's the jump that matters — roughly doubling to tripling the protective film. Going from 12 mil to 20 mil is a different class of floor. Going from 20 mil to 22 mil is a 10% increase on a spec that's already past the point where household traffic is the limiting factor. Neither of those floors is going to wear through in your living room.

So when does 22 mil actually earn its keep?
There are real cases. They're just narrower than the marketing implies:
In a genuinely punishing commercial setting — a busy restaurant entry, a gym floor, a retail aisle with cart traffic — every mil of headroom counts, and the incremental cost is trivial against the cost of closing to re-floor. If you're specifying for that, take the thicker layer.
In a home, the failure mode almost never looks like "the wear layer wore through." It looks like a deep gouge from something dragged across it, a plank damaged in one spot, or a floor that got tired of being cleaned with the wrong product. None of those are solved by two more mils.
- Heavy commercial traffic — genuine wear-through risk; more is better.
- Rolling loads — carts, office chairs on hard casters, pallet jacks.
- Residential — 20 mil is already past the threshold; the extra 2 mil is insurance you'll never claim.
The specs that matter more than those two mils
If you're comparing two floors and one is 20 mil and the other is 22, you're looking at the wrong line on the spec sheet. Here's what actually separates a floor that ages well from one that doesn't:
The core. An SPC (stone polymer composite) core is dense and dimensionally stable — it doesn't expand and contract much with temperature swings, and it bridges minor subfloor imperfections instead of telegraphing them. A softer or hollower core will show every ridge underneath and can dent from a point load even with a thick wear layer on top.
Surface treatment. Wear layers aren't all the same material. A ceramic-bead or urethane-reinforced surface resists scuffing differently than a bare vinyl film of the same thickness. Two 20-mil floors can behave quite differently.
Embossing and finish. A low-sheen, textured surface hides micro-scratches that a glossy floor advertises. This is why a cheap glossy floor looks worse at year two than a matte floor with the same wear layer.
The warranty, and what voids it. A long warranty number means little if the exclusions swallow it. Read what's actually covered.
How to ask about this without getting sold
Three questions will tell you more than an hour in a showroom:
Ask for the wear layer in mils, separately from the plank thickness in millimetres. If you get one number, you asked the wrong person or they gave you the wrong answer on purpose.
Ask what the core is — SPC, WPC, or flexible LVT. These are meaningfully different products that all get called "vinyl plank."
Ask to see the spec sheet. Not a brochure — the actual sheet. Any supplier who can't produce one for the product they're quoting is telling you something.

Frequently asked questions
+ Is a 22 mil wear layer better than 20 mil?
Technically yes — it's 10% more protective film. Practically, in a home, no. Both are commercial-grade specifications well beyond what residential traffic demands. The meaningful difference is between those and the 6–12 mil wear layers common in builder-grade and big-box vinyl plank.
+ What wear layer do I need for a house with dogs?
20 mil is ample. Dog nails are a scratching risk, not a wear-through risk, so what protects you is the hardness and texture of the surface rather than raw thickness. A matte, textured 20-mil floor over a rigid core handles pets well. See our page on pet-friendly flooring for the full picture.
+ Is wear layer the same as plank thickness?
No, and conflating them is the most common mix-up in flooring. The wear layer is the clear top film, measured in mils (thousandths of an inch). Plank thickness is the whole board, measured in millimetres. A 5.5mm plank with a 20-mil wear layer is describing two separate things.
+ Can a wear layer be refinished or repaired if it's damaged?
No — unlike hardwood, LVP can't be sanded and refinished. But you don't need to. Because it's installed as individual planks, a damaged board can be replaced on its own without touching the rest of the floor, which is faster and cheaper than refinishing a whole room.
+ Does a thicker wear layer make the floor quieter or warmer?
Not meaningfully. Acoustics and underfoot warmth come from the core and any attached underlayment, not the wear layer. If quiet matters — a condo, an upstairs room — ask about the attached pad and the floor's sound ratings instead.
